Title : 
All-in-one 60 GHz CMOS transceiver for proximity wireless communication
         
        
        
            Author_Institution : 
Toshiba Corp., Japan
         
        
        
        
        
            Abstract : 
This paper introduces our developed 60 GHz CMOS transceiver for high-speed proximity wireless communication. Its feature is an all-in-one chip configuration including a package-in antenna, RFSW, RF, ADC/DAC and digital signal processing in 65 nm process technology. This transceiver provides high-speed throughput of 2 Gb/s with power consumption of 581 mW and 687 mW for transmit and receive mode.
